Lev Vygotsky
A Soviet psychologist best known for his theories on cognitive development, particularly the social development theory which emphasizes the fundamental role of social interaction in the development of cognition.
Assimilation
The cognitive process where new information is integrated into existing cognitive schemas, beliefs, and understandings.
Accommodate
In cognitive psychology, to modify existing cognitive schemas, perceptions, or understandings to incorporate new information.
Formal Operations
The final stage in Piaget's theory of cognitive development, characterized by the ability to think abstractly, logically, and systematically.
